How do relaxers affect hair protein?
Relaxers chemically break and rearrange hair's natural protein bonds, creating a new, permanently straightened structure that reduces tensile strength and elasticity.

What are the distinctions between protein coating and protein penetration for hair health?
Protein coating smooths hair's surface, while penetration rebuilds internal structure, with molecular size and hair porosity guiding their distinct effects.

How does hair follicle shape influence curl pattern?
Hair follicle shape dictates curl pattern; round follicles yield straight strands, while oval to flattened shapes create waves and coils.

What is the scientific basis for silk hair protection at night?
Silk's smooth surface significantly reduces friction and absorbs less moisture, safeguarding hair's cuticle and hydration during sleep.
